Hillary Clinton became the latest Democrat to slam Gov. Kristi Noem (R-S.D) over shooting her dog.

On Monday, Clinton wrote “Still true” on X/Twitter in response to a 2021 post on the platform where she wrote at the time, “don’t vote for anyone you wouldn’t trust with your dog.”

Noem, who is reportedly on a shortlist of potential Trump running mates, describes in her upcoming book how she led her 14-month-old family dog named Cricket, to a gravel pit and shot her after she ruined a pheasant hunt by being “out of her mind with excitement, chasing all those birds and having the time of her life” and after she attacked a local family’s chickens.

The Republican governor also described shooting and killing a “nasty and mean” male goat that smelled “disgusting, musky and rancid” and  liked to chase her children.

Noem defended the move on Sunday, saying she was being “responsible” and following the law.

“I can understand why some people are upset about a 20 year old story of Cricket, one of the working dogs at our ranch, in my upcoming book — No Going Back. The book is filled with many honest stories of my life, good and bad days,” she wrote in a post on X/Twitter.

“The fact is, South Dakota law states that dogs who attack and kill livestock can be put down. Given that Cricket had shown aggressive behavior toward people by biting them, I decided what I did,” Noem added.
